* On 10-Jan-2005 at 11:42AM PST, Brendan Miller said:
> 
> If I manually permit (using the fw_exception script) the IP and MAC of the 
> VPN user, his VPN works perfectly, albeit he is not subjected to the splash
> page and has no renewal window with which to contend.  We would like to keep
> the splash page/renewal process intact--how can we handle the VPN tunnel
> situation?

I fear that there is not much to be done about this on the gateway
side. Obviously you can't intercept specific VPN connections, so you
need to find some way to keep users from having their gateway for
local network connections go down the VPN. How you accomplish this I
cannot guess, sorry. :-/
